in that? Casseroles or one-pot meals generally go over well with
the kids; and are simple to put together.
Taste this simple meal:
1 – lb. ground beef
1 - 16 oz jar spaghetti sauce
1 - cup water
1 1/2 cups uncooked elbow macaroni
1 - cup shredded mozzarella cheese
Set beef into a 3-quart glass bowl and microwave for 4-5
minutes, or until beef is no longer pink. Stir & rotate part
way through cooking time. Drain Beef. Stir in sauce, water and
macaroni. Microwave another 13 minutes, stirring part way
through. Sprinkle cheese on top and allow to sit covered
approximately 5 minutes before eating. Serves a couple famished
kids.
There are numerous meals you can cook with lean ground beef.
Any recipe that calls for lean ground beef will work just fine
replaced with ground turkey, chicken or venison as an
alternative. The simple recipe below uses ground meat. It takes
close to an hour to cook but merely a blink to prepare.
Mix together:
2 lbs. ground meat
1 can condensed cheddar cheese soup
1 can condensed cream of mushroom soup
One bag of Crinkle Cut French Fries
Brown ground beef and strain the grease. Add both soups to
strained ground beef and spoon into a 9 x 12 greased pan. Top
with cut French fries and cook at 350 degrees for 50-55 minutes
or until fries are golden brown.
Taco salads are very quick and easy to make. Start with
lettuce. Add onion, tomato and cheese (if your kids will
approve of it.) Fry up some hamburger and toss in a packet of
taco seasoning – or just include some taco sauce to the meat.
Next add smashed tortilla chips or Fritos. Top with salsa or
Catalina salad dressing. Don't forget the sour cream and
guacamole too! Kids love this meal!

What about a sweet twist to the standard mac 'n cheesekids
recipe?
1 (16 ounce) box macaroni (elbow, seashell, bowtie – doesn't
matter, just not spaghetti)
1 c. cottage cheese
1/4 c. sugar
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1. Cook macaroni according to package instructions.
2. Stir in sugar, cottage cheese,and cinnamon with drained
macaroni.
3. Nibble and add sugar and cinnamon, if required.
4. Serve immediately. Delicious!
